I visited India last fall and wore long sleeve button down shirts or twinsets and trousers (a little nicer than khakis). The Indian women I met with at work were similarly attired, or wearing traditional sari outfits. Our company's executive women have generally worn pant suits and button down shirts from what I've seen and heard. Some additional guidance I received was to avoid anything too tight and not wear anything that shows your shoulders (outside of hotel spa/fitness centers).
That said, khakis and polo shirts are generally fine for weekends and lounging around at the hotel.
